Intrauterine Insemination (IUI)

Intrauterine Insemination (IUI) is a widely used, non-invasive first-line fertility treatment designed to bridge the gap between natural conception and more complex assisted reproductive technologies. This procedure involves placing specially washed and concentrated sperm directly into the uterus around the time of ovulation. By bypassing the cervix and reducing the distance sperm must travel to reach the egg, IUI significantly increases the chances of fertilization for many couples.

When You Should Consider IUI

  • Unexplained infertility where no clear biological barrier has been identified.

  • Mild male factor infertility, including slightly lower sperm count or motility.

  • Cervical mucus issues that may prevent sperm from entering the uterus naturally.

  • Use of donor sperm for single women or same-sex couples.

  • Semen allergy (rare cases) where proteins in the seminal fluid cause a reaction.

  • Ejaculatory dysfunction or physical barriers to natural intercourse.

Conditions That Require Specialized Care

  •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S) requiring carefully monitored ovulation induction.

  • Endometriosis (Stage I or II) where pelvic anatomy remains relatively undisturbed.

  • Minor hormonal imbalances that interfere with regular ovulation cycles.

  • Vaginismus or other conditions that make traditional intercourse difficult.

  • Cases requiring "washed" sperm to remove prostaglandins that cause uterine cramping.

How Intrauterine Insemination Is Performed

  • Ovulation is tracked through at-home monitoring kits or clinical ultrasound scans.

  • Ovarian stimulation may be used to encourage the development of one to three mature follicles.

  • A sperm sample is collected and "washed" in a specialized lab to isolate highly motile sperm.

  • The concentrated sperm sample is loaded into a thin, flexible, high-precision catheter.

  • The physician gently inserts the catheter through the cervix and into the uterine cavity.

  • The sperm is injected directly into the uterus, a process that takes only a few minutes and requires no anesthesia.

Modern Innovations in IUI

  • Advanced Sperm Washing (Density Gradient)A refined laboratory technique that separates the healthiest, most motile sperm from debris and immotile cells.

  • AI-Powered Follicle TrackingAutomated ultrasound software that precisely predicts the peak window of ovulation for optimal timing.

  • Microfluidic Sperm SelectionA gentle, chemical-free sorting method that selects sperm with the highest DNA integrity.

  • High-Definition Insemination CathetersUltra-thin, soft-tip catheters designed to minimize uterine irritation and maximize patient comfort.

  • Hormonal Trigger OptimizationThe use of precision medications to ensure the egg is released exactly when the sperm is introduced.

  • Digital Cycle MonitoringIntegrated health apps that allow patients to sync their monitoring data directly with the clinic’s laboratory.

Pre-Procedure Preparation

  • Comprehensive fertility screening to ensure the fallopian tubes are open and functional.

  • Lifestyle adjustments, including a balanced diet and moderate exercise, to support egg and sperm quality.

  • Coordination of a monitoring schedule to identify the exact 24-48 hour window of ovulation.

  • Abstinence for 2-5 days for the male partner prior to the procedure to optimize the sperm sample.

  • Discussion of the potential for multiple pregnancies if using ovulation-stimulating medications.

Pre-Procedure Tests

  • Hysterosalpingogram (HSG) to confirm that at least one fallopian tube is clear.

  • Semen analysis to ensure the processed sample will meet the minimum motile sperm count.

  • Anti-Müllerian Hormone (AMH) and FSH testing to assess ovarian reserve.

  • Transvaginal Ultrasound to measure the thickness of the endometrial lining.

  • Standard infectious disease screening for both partners as required by medical protocols.

Why This Treatment Is Highly Effective

  • Acts as a successful, low-cost entry point for couples with mild fertility hurdles.

  • Bypasses "cervical factor" infertility, where the cervix may be hostile to sperm.

  • Delivers a high concentration of motile sperm directly to the site of fertilization.

  • Allows for a more natural conception process compared to IVF, as fertilization still occurs within the body.

  • Provides high cumulative success rates, with many couples achieving pregnancy within three to six cycles.

Recovery and Monitoring

  • Patients can return to all normal daily activities immediately following the procedure.

  • Minor spotting or light cramping may occur but typically resolves within a few hours.

  • A "Two-Week Wait" (2WW) period begins, during which the patient monitors for early signs of pregnancy.

  • A follow-up pregnancy test (urine or blood-based Beta-hCG) is performed 14 days post-IUI.

  • If successful, a confirmatory ultrasound is scheduled to monitor early fetal development.

Life After IUI

  • Transition to routine obstetric care for a healthy, natural-term pregnancy.

  • Resolution of infertility through a less invasive and more affordable medical pathway.

  • Opportunity to move toward more advanced treatments (like IVF) if IUI does not result in pregnancy after several attempts.

  • Ongoing reproductive health monitoring to prepare for future family-building goals.

  • Peace of mind from having utilized a scientifically proven, time-tested fertility method.
